Which is better globe valve or gate valve?
Globe valves generally seal better than gate valves and last longer. They are more expensive than similarly sized gate valves, but may be worth the extra expense in situations where throttling is needed.
What is difference between globe valve and gate valve?
Gate valves are also designed differently than globe valves. Instead of a disc, these valves have gate faces that are parallel or wedge shaped, and they’re designed with a rising or a non-rising stem. Most importantly, gate valves can be set in any directional flow. Globe valves, on the other hand, can’t.
Can we use globe valve in place of gate valve?
The globe valve can be repaired in place while nearly all gate valves need to be removed from the piping system to have leakage problems repaired. A globe valve can be opened against a high differential pressure, while a gate valve will bind and cannot be opened.
Can a gate valve be used to control flow?
A gate valve is generally used to completely shut off fluid flow or, in the fully open position, provide full flow in a pipeline. Gate valves are generally not suitable for regulating flow or pressure or operating in a partially open condition. For this service, a plug valve or a control valve should be used.
